Market Snapshot: License Plate Grade Reflective Sheeting Market

The license plate grade reflective sheeting market grew from USD 157.46 million in 2024 to USD 165.23 million in 2025 and is forecasted to reach USD 233.03 million by 2032, at a CAGR of 5.02%. Market expansion is underpinned by stricter global safety standards, heightened regulatory scrutiny, and accelerated technology adoption by manufacturers and plate issuers, reflecting both stability and dynamic change across regional demand centers.

Tariff Impact: Navigating Shifts in Sourcing and Cost Structures

Recent United States tariffs on select license plate reflective sheeting imports have driven supply chain realignment and strategic investment in domestic production capacity. Manufacturers are optimizing sourcing strategies and distribution agreements to maintain cost competitiveness. This regulatory environment also accelerates collaborative initiatives, such as co-location partnerships and process innovation, ensuring supply chain resilience for government and commercial buyers.
